    We decided on the Maison Boulud inside the Ritz Carlton that we can walk to for our last meal in Montreal last November. The hamachi sashimi with coconut milk, lemongrass and Buddha's hand grated table side was delicious and I was excited for what else was to come. With the arrival of a shipment of white truffles, we had to share an order of white truffle tagliarini special before it even made it on the dinner menu. I definitely was thinking, "let it rain" as the truffle was being shaved over the house made tagliarini. I originally thought the white truffle tagliarini was enough for dinner for that price so did not order an entree while my husband put in his order of the tenderloin. However, after the pasta was brought out first and I was asked what I wanted for an entree, I decided better add the sea bass. Unfortunately, because they put in the tenderloin order before my sea bass, it was already made and sitting under a heat lamp. The result was his medium rare tenderloin was disappointingly overcooked by the time we got the dish and the sea bass surprisingly bland. With the price they charge, I wish they would have thought it out better.

    SO and I decided to treat ourselves to a nice lunch in this fancy place. The restaurant is located in, and adjacent to, the Ritz-Carlton, where you can also treat yourself to a fancy tea service. Some things that were nice surprises: 1. The 2-course prix fixe is 45 cad (the 3-course is 55 cad). 2. The sommelier didn't seem to care that we were only getting a cocktail and a glass of wine. 3. They didn't mind that we were dressed casually. The SO and I went for the 2 course lunch (and they gave us the option to mix and match between apps, mains and desserts or to make it 3 courses later if we chose).  For appetizers, SO had the salmon tartar and I had the artichoke salad...both were very fresh and tasty.  For mains, we both had the cod, which was healthy and satisfying. Bottom line, if you're in the mood to treat yourself to high quality food and high level service in a bourgie establishment and at a reasonable price, then this is the place to be! Note 1: There is a dining area with a glass roof, which seems popular, but you need to have a reservation, which we didn't have (btw, reservations can easily be made via opentable!). We didn't mind not being in that section because it seemed loud in there with all the conversations going on and we were perfectly fine in the quieter section with the fireplace and soothing, old school jazz playing in the background. Note 2: Pass on the alcoholic beverages if you're on a budget.

    I stayed at the hotel and had wonderful breakfasts here every morning of my summer stay. The breakfast menu was delicious and I especially enjoyed the pancakes out of all the options- but everything was really fantastic. The servers got to know us throughout the course of our stay and greeted us by name every day. They also sat us in the same table with an excellent view of the pond and the ducks. We watched the ducks wake up every morning. I came for dinner one night to celebrate my birthday. I opted for the tasting menu with wine pairings for almost every course. The dinner waiter was equally as wonderful, charming and entertaining as the breakfast staff. And the sommelier chatted with us about each wine and explained the origins and flavor profile etc. She chose perfectly matched wines for each course. Really a fantastic experience all around in regards to service and high quality food. They also took care to note food allergies which is always comforting. Absolutely lovely and a must visit if possible.

    Ate here the other night and had a great time and experience. There were 6 of us and we each had a fantastic meal. The ambiance at this restaurant is the perfect mix of casual nice. It's not overly stuffy but is on the nicer side. We sat inside but the outside looks even more beautiful and I want to sit there next time! Really pretty environment. 5 stars for ambiance! The restaurant is located in the Ritz Carlton lobby, but also has a street entry. We had appetizers to start. The fois gras was unbelievable. For mains, I ordered the lamb and it was cooked perfectly. We all got a bunch of sides to accompany and each was delicious but the carrots were really special- surprising right?! Dessert was just as good as everything else. - def 5* for food Service through the night was fantastic. Not in your face but there when you need someone. -5* Definitely will be back and recommend if you are looking for a good meal.
